// Heads up: THUMB_QUEUE_MAX_DEPTH caps how many pending jobs the
// Snapgristle thumbnail queue will hold before we start shedding
// low-priority resizes. Don't crank this up just because the dashboard
// looks scary — the workers at Dovebranch drain bursts fine, and a
// deeper queue just means stale thumbnails. If you change it, run the
// soak suite and note the result in the queue changelog. The constant
// below was tuned against the build whose token follows this comment.

build token for tahop-fafof: htk14_2d55df8101eccc

**Ticket: Cron drift on Larkspur batch hosts**

The nightly reconcile job on the Larkspur fleet runs with a schedule that no longer matches what's in the repo. Someone hand-edited the crontab on three hosts in the Velwick region around the last incident and never backported it. Before I revert, please review the live values pulled from the primary host, shown below.

deployment values, yadup-kadug:
[sorys]
port = 5672
team = noveth
host = sorys.orvexcorp.example
region = south-4
access_code = ac_deddc1
timeout_ms = 1500

**Ticket: SFTP drop config drift — Marrowfield partner feed**

The staging and production definitions for the Marrowfield inbound SFTP drop have diverged: polling interval, archive behavior, and retry policy no longer match. Reviewers should check the attached change against the canonical spec, not staging. For reference, the intended production settings are as follows.

settings of tagef-bawif:
DRUIX_HOST=druix.zemvarlabs.internal
DRUIX_PORT=8000